I’ve been using this app for several years, and it’s been a must-have for me. It’s simple, effective, and I really enjoy it. However, I have one suggestion that would make it even more useful for me and others and significantly improve the user experience. Instead of keeping dozens or even hundreds of sheets in a single window, it would be great to have the option to organize them into folders or custom sections. For example, I’d like to create a folder for “Business A” to keep all related sheets together, another for “Business B,” and one for personal or household expenses. This would help keep everything organized and reduce the clutter between sheets for different purposes. I hope you’ll consider adding this feature. Thank you!
